Altona
Advantages
Altona has a strong job market, particularly in media, advertising, and creative industries.
The borough offers excellent public transport connections via S-Bahn and U-Bahn, ensuring easy commutes.
Altona is known for its diverse, family-friendly environment and beautiful Elbe river views.
The area features a lively cultural scene with numerous restaurants, cafes, bars, and farmer's markets.
Altona is considered a safe place to live, with a safety rating of 4 out of 5.
Drawbacks
Rent in Altona is higher compared to some other districts within Hamburg.
Finding an apartment in Altona can be challenging due to high demand and low vacancy rates.
Some parts of Altona can feel too quiet in the evenings, depending on the specific neighborhood.
Parking can be confusing due to the prevalence of one-way streets.
There are reports of visible drug users and alcoholics near the train station, though they are generally described as peaceful.
